On April 21st, Prime Minister Narendra Modi will address the nation’s civil servants at Vigyan Bhawan in New Delhi, marking the 17th Civil Services Day. The event, set to begin at 11 AM, will also see the Prime Minister confer the prestigious Prime Minister’s Awards for Excellence in Public Administration.

This year, 16 awards will be presented to civil servants who have demonstrated outstanding performance in key areas such as the Holistic Development of Districts, the Aspirational Blocks Programme, and Innovation in public administration.
